Anthony Espinoza is a minor antagonist in the 2009 third-person shooter action-adventure video game The Godfather II. He was one of the caporegimes of the Granados Crime Family and their chairman and leader in New York.
Biography[]
Anthony Espinoza was a part of the crime family from the very start as a part of Stanley Jimenez's regime. Despite having lost two of his fingers during Rico Granados' rise to power in Miami and having been wounded from a car bombing, he is still an efficient marksman and leads the crime family in New York. In the summer of 1959, Espinoza was shot dead by Dominic Trapani while he talked with an informant inside the Corleone and Trapani family.
